The Ketogenic Diet: A Powerful Shift in Nutrition for Modern Health
The Ketogenic Diet has rapidly gained global attention as one of the most transformative approaches to weight management, metabolic health, and overall wellness. Originally developed in the early 20th century as a therapeutic treatment for epilepsy, this low-carbohydrate, high-fat diet has evolved into a mainstream lifestyle choice embraced by millions. At its core, the ketogenic diet focuses on drastically reducing carbohydrate intake while increasing fat consumption, forcing the body to enter a metabolic state known as Ketosis. In this state, the body shifts from using glucose as its primary energy source to burning fat, producing molecules called ketones that fuel the brain and body.
One of the key reasons behind the popularity of the ketogenic diet is its effectiveness in promoting rapid weight loss. By limiting carbohydrates, insulin levels drop significantly, allowing the body to access stored fat more efficiently. Unlike traditional calorie-restrictive diets, keto encourages satiety through healthy fats and moderate protein intake, reducing hunger and cravings. Many individuals report not only weight loss but also improved energy levels, mental clarity, and reduced brain fog, making it particularly appealing in today’s fast-paced lifestyle.
Beyond weight loss, the ketogenic diet has shown promising benefits for metabolic health. Research indicates that it can help regulate blood sugar levels, making it beneficial for individuals with Type 2 Diabetes and insulin resistance. By minimizing glucose spikes and improving insulin sensitivity, keto can contribute to better long-term glycemic control. Additionally, studies suggest improvements in cholesterol markers, including increased HDL (good cholesterol) and reduced triglycerides, though results may vary depending on food quality and individual response.
Another fascinating area of exploration is the diet’s impact on brain health. Since ketones serve as an efficient fuel source for the brain, the ketogenic diet is being studied for its potential role in neurological conditions such as Alzheimer’s Disease and Parkinson’s disease. Early findings suggest that ketones may help reduce inflammation and oxidative stress in the brain, offering protective benefits. This has sparked growing interest in keto as more than just a weight-loss tool, but as a therapeutic dietary intervention.
However, despite its benefits, the ketogenic diet is not without challenges. The initial transition phase, often referred to as the “keto flu,” can cause symptoms such as fatigue, headaches, irritability, and dizziness as the body adapts to burning fat instead of carbohydrates. Long-term adherence can also be difficult due to the restrictive nature of the diet, especially in cultures where carbohydrate-rich foods like rice, bread, and grains are dietary staples. Moreover, if not followed correctly, keto can lead to nutrient deficiencies, digestive issues, and excessive intake of unhealthy fats.
It is also important to note that the ketogenic diet is not a one-size-fits-all solution. Individuals with certain medical conditions, such as liver disorders or pancreatitis, should approach this diet with caution and under medical supervision. Personalized nutrition plays a crucial role, and what works effectively for one person may not yield the same results for another.
